MS-2A

Circuit Breaker and Overcurrent Relay Test Set

DESCRIPTION

The Megger MS-2A test set is used around the world by

several thousand utility companies, industrial plants and

electrical service organizations.

Model MS-2A is a self-contained test set that incorporates a

variable high-current output and appropriate control

circuitry and instrumentation for testing thermal, magnetic

or solid-state motor overload relays, molded-case circuit

breakers, ground-fault trip devices and overcurrent relays.

APPLICATIONS

Model MS-2A is capable of testing the time-delay

characteristics of overcurrent relays, motor overload relays

and molded-case circuit breakers rated up to 125 amperes,

when following the recommended test procedure of testing

the time delay of these devices at three times their rating.

Higher currents are available for the short durations

required to test an instantaneous trip element. For

example, the test set will provide a maximum short-

duration output of 750 amperes through a typical,

125 ampere, molded-case circuit breaker.

The MS-2A is ideal for testing ground fault protection

devises with window CT’s. The NEC 230.95C requires

specific ground fault devices be performance tested when

initially installed.

The MS-2A is commonly used by many utilities and service

organizations as a economical light weight overcurrent

relay test system.

Additional applications include verifying the ratio of

current transformers and testing panelboard ammeters

and voltmeters.

FEATURES AND BENEFITS

I

Rugged and lightweight: Unit weighs only 33 lb

(15 kg) and is tough enough to withstand daily field

or plant use.

I

Digital memory ammeter: High-accuracy, direct-

reading instrument has read-and-hold memory for

measurement of short-duration currents. Ideal for testing

ground fault devices, overcurrent relays and molded

case circuit breakers.

I

Digital, multirange timer: Crystal-controlled, high-

accuracy instrument with autoranging measures

operating time to 1 millisecond.

I

High-current output: Provides instantaneous currents

up to 750 amperes through a 125 ampere breaker in a

small 33lb (15kg) package

SPECIFICATIONS

Input

Input Voltage (specify one): 120 V OR 240 V, 50/60 Hz, 1

φ

Output

Output Ranges: The output is continuously adjustable in four

ranges to accommodate a variety of test-circuit impedances:

0 to 5 A at 120 V max.

0 to 25 A at 24 V max.

0 to 120 A at 6 V max.

0 to 240 A at 3 V max.
